Ya se me olvido que es def o por que lo ponemos y en visual code no dice, alguien me puede sacar de dudas, pls?

Isabel Sánchez

Isabel Sánchez

Pregunta
studenthace 4 años

Ya se me olvido que es def o por que lo ponemos y en visual code no dice, alguien me puede sacar de dudas, pls?

5 respuestas
para escribir tu comentario
    Moisés Manuel Morín Hevia

    Moisés Manuel Morín Hevia

    studenthace 4 años

    Es la palabra reservada para que Python sepa que estas creando una función.

    Christopher Eder Chantres Justo

    Christopher Eder Chantres Justo

    studenthace 4 años

    Hola isabeldelosreyes, básicamente deff indica que es una ++función++, a las funciones se le pueden agregar parámetros los cuales van entre paréntesis (), las funciones sirven para reducir nuestro código.

    Christian Alvarenga

    Christian Alvarenga

    studenthace 4 años

    Te explico, también me costo un poco entender pero es muy sencillo. 😅

    La función def sirve para (como su nombre lo indica) definir valores, tanto numéricos como textuales.

    Usando el ejemplo del video, podemos ver lo siguiente:

    def conversor (tipo_pesos, valor_dolar):

    Al comienzo se utiliza la función def, luego vemos que le asigna un nombre a la función, que en este caso seria conversor, y dentro de los paréntesis se ponen los nombres de los valores que luego vamos a definir.

    Mas abajo podemos ver el siguiente código:

    conversor ("colombianos", 3875)

    Lo que se hace aquí es invocar la función def, mediante el nombre que le asignamos mas arriba, que era conversor, luego en los paréntesis, le asignamos los valores a tipo_pesos, que seria "colombianos" (en comillas por que es un texto) y luego a valor_dolar que seria 3875 (no lleva comillas por que en este caso no es un valor textual, sino numérico).

    Espero que haya podido ser claro y que se me entienda. 😂

    Sino me puedes hacer cualquier pregunta.

    Sebastián Andrade

    Sebastián Andrade

    studenthace 4 años

    Hola ¿a que te refieres con que no dice? el keyword def significa define, y se usa para definir funciones

    Abel Salas Leal

    Abel Salas Leal

    studenthace 4 años

    Es una palabra reservada de Py para declarar funciones ¡Saludos!

Curso Básico de Python [Empieza Gratis]

Curso Básico de Python [Empieza Gratis]

Aprende a programar desde cero con el lenguaje de mayor crecimiento en el planeta: Python. Descubre qué es un algoritmo y cómo se construye uno. Domina las variables, funciones, estructuras de datos, los condicionales y ciclos.

Curso Básico de Python [Empieza Gratis]
Curso Básico de Python [Empieza Gratis]

Curso Básico de Python [Empieza Gratis]

Aprende a programar desde cero con el lenguaje de mayor crecimiento en el planeta: Python. Descubre qué es un algoritmo y cómo se construye uno. Domina las variables, funciones, estructuras de datos, los condicionales y ciclos.